Marcus Cerny, the Deputy Director of the PhD Academy at London School of Economics has won the Haplo sponsorship for the UKCGE conference in Porto in July.
The conference is UKCGE’s keynote event of the year, and will be attended by colleagues and stakeholders in the postgraduate sector, from across the UK, Europe and beyond.
Held at the Universidade do Porto, on Thursday 6th and Friday 7th of July 2017, the theme of this year’s conference is Postgraduate Education in the European Context: Successes, Challenges Transitions and Futures. Delegates will have the opportunity to explore local landmarks including Porto’s Clerigos Tower, Ribeira, Serralves and Casa Musica, as well attend the popular UKCGE Annual Conference Dinner in an unforgettable setting.

The UK Council for Graduate Education is the leading independent representative body for postgraduate education in the UK, providing high-quality leadership and support to our members, to promote a strong and sustainable national postgraduate sector. UKCGE is made up of over 130 HEIs in the UK and internationally.
